COVID-19 legislation signed by Governor Cuomo enables Paid Family Leave to be used by an eligible employee if they, or their minor dependent child, are subject to a mandatory or precautionary order of quarantine or isolation issued by the state of New York, the Department of Health, local board of health, or any government entity duly authorized to issue such order due to COVID … Teachers are leaving the classroom because of COVID-19 and fears that school's will not be able to protect them and their students. Employees can also take up to 12 weeks of paid leave at two-thirds pay to care for a child whose school or child-care provider is closed or unavailable due to COVID-19.
